Just finished my w9 r2 and sat with my breakfast just thinking about my last few runs which haven't all gone to plan and thought about what I have learnt from them
1 never ever let the gremlins get to you or the local druggy couple laughing when your nearly home π€¬
2 if it just isn't feeling right it's ok to stop and walk home and do the run another day
3 I need to warm up longer than the 5 minute brisk walk
4 I do not need to take my water bottle with me
5 a banana about an hour before my run in a morning seems to help
6 don't give a damn about people seeing you when your out
7 vary the route and just take any street I fancy at the time (as long as it's not a steep hill 2π€£)
